蜗牛娱乐网讯, 据外媒 3 月 13 日消息,四名加拿大男子因在多个城市对比特币 ATM 进行双花攻击而被通缉。
蜗牛娱乐网讯, 据外媒 3 月 13 日消息,四名加拿大男子因在多个城市对比特币 ATM 进行双花攻击而被通缉。
这个团伙总共对比特币 ATM 机进行了 112 次双花攻击,获得的利润达到了 20 多万美元,平均每次攻击获利 1800 美元。
ATM 机被双花 112 次
据介绍,2018 年 9 月 16 日到 26 日期间,这四名男子在 7 个城市对比特币 ATM 进行双花攻击。这七个城市分别是卡尔加里、多伦多、蒙特利尔、渥太华、温尼伯、汉密尔顿和舍伍德公园。而其中近一半非法交易发生在卡尔加里。
警方认为嫌疑人利用“双花攻击”的方式获利:先从比特币自动取款机获取现金,然后在自动取款机公司处理这笔取款请求之前远程取消交易。
目前,卡尔加里警方、安大略省和曼尼托巴省警察局目前已经通过合作,获得了 4 位嫌疑人的监控图像。
零确认交易是罪魁?
这些被攻击的 ATM 机,都是接受零确认交易的。有人认为,嫌疑人就是利用了这一点,双花比特币。
零确认交易是发送方将交易发送给其他的网络进行广播但是尚未确认的交易。
一旦交易进行广播将会加入到缓冲空间内存池(mempool )中,并且需要一直等到纳入被挖的区块中。但是从交易到达内存池到被矿工挖出的这段时间中,很多事情都可能发生。
简单理解,就是交易被矿工打包记录在链上之前的交易。接受零确认交易的商家,会选择相信你不会作恶,先将商品提供给你。
RBF 也要负责?
仅仅是因为 ATM 机接受零确认交易造成的吗?
加密货币社区成员(主要是 BCH 和 BSV)提出了另一种说法,即加拿大比特币 Core 开发者 Peter Todd 所提出的费用替代法(RBF)工具,使得这些双花交易成为可能。
这位被 Roger Ver 点赞的哥们儿是这么认为的:
“这些家伙使用 RBF 对比特币 ATM 机进行了双花攻击,通过 112 笔交易偷走了 20 多万美元。 Samson 是对的,比特币不再是一个支付系统。”
而作为 RBF 方案的提出者,Peter Todd 当然不想背这个锅,他是这么说的:
“不是的,RBF 对此不背锅。比特币从根本上就无法保证链上的零确认交易。从来没有,也永远不会。那些声称不这样做的人,是无知或不诚实的,他们常常向你推销不安全的产品。‘零确认强盗’很好。”
RBF 为什么背锅?RBF 又是什么呢?
RBF 叫做替代法工具,全称是 replace-by-fee,即如果用同一个地址发起两笔交易,则手续费更高的交易会先被矿工打包。采纳 RBF 费用替代法,有一个弊端即,使得零确认的交易容易被双花。
随着比特币的用户越来越多,在 1M 的区块容量下,网络很容易变得拥堵。自比特币诞生以来,中本聪原先就设计了先到先得的交易规则。也就是说,如果同时有两笔合法的交易,其中先到达节点的交易就会被优先采纳。而使用了 RBF 后,如果你用同一个地址发送两笔交易,手续费高的那一笔交易会优先被矿工打包。一旦有一笔交易被打包进区块链了,那另一笔交易会自动作废。
用一个形象的比喻:车站规定,不论是谁来乘车,都必须按照先后顺序排队等着,车每十分钟一辆,按照这样的流程运输客人。后来车站为了考虑到那些确实很紧急的客人,于是修改了规则,谁愿意出多的车费,谁就能先上车。
但是修改规则后,有些人发现有可趁之机——双花,将一笔钱花两次或者更多次。
如何实现呢?他先正常给卖家转账 1 个比特币,我们假设叫做 TX1,随后再将相同的 1 个比特币转给自己的另一个,地址,我们称为 TX2。他希望系统能先打包 TX2,于是将 TX2 的手续费提高,使其更容易被矿工优先打包,这样他的钱就都回到自己的口袋里,而发给卖家的交易 TX1,由于相冲突就会作废。(火鸟财经) 蜗牛娱乐(www.woniuyulew.com)亚洲最具人气线上娱乐平台